Betty Balanoff a
model citizen of Hammond. She has dedicated 25 years to educating students at
Roosevelt High School in East Chicago. Not only was she a devoted teacher, but a
concerned citizen as well. Over the years, she has worked on a number of
projects that involve preserving the rights of the community. When the Hammond,
East Chicago, Gary Sanitary Districts released raw sewage into the Grand Calumet
River, she was there to lobby for a new and well-deserved Sanitary District.
When the Rhodia Corp., a organic sulfuric acid recycling plant, wanted to
obtain a permit for handling hazardous waste, she was there to make sure that
the City Council implement tougher rules and regulations.
